You'll never run out of power again! If the battery on your smartphone or tablet is running low... no problem. Just plug your device into the USB port on the top of this portable battery charger, and then continue to use your device while it gets recharged.
With a recharge capacity of 5200 mAh, this charger will give you 1.5 full recharges of your smartphone or recharge your tablet to 50% capacity.
When the battery charger runs out of power, just plug it into the wall using the supplied cable (included), and it will recharge itself for your next use.

Richard's 2020 painting "BOROUGHMUIR OLD SCHOOL - Past and Present " was commissioned by the BFPA ( Boroughmuir Former Pupils Association) and he has produced an EXCLUSIVE LIMITED EDITION of 100 FINE ART PRINTS of the painting . Individually Signed and Numbered copies of these (A4 image on A3 art paper) should be ordered directly from Richard get details re charges by clicking on CONTACT or emailing rchdig@aol.com When not painting commissions, for variety and for fun he enjoys painting animal portraits ( especially horses, cats and dogs), local scenes, gardens and favourite flowers, usually painted in acrylics on board or canvas.
